She's a Dinafem CBD Kush Auto. There are a few pics of the whole plant in my blog.

I suspect that most CS failures are caused by either poor colloidal solution or not enough of it. I went through about 1.5 liters of full strength solution to get to this point, and she is a small plant. I think the answer to CS is to make your own a liter at a time like I did. My el cheapo generator setup that I document in my blog is super cheap and easy, and obviously works. The only significant disadvantage to CS is the daily application, but for me that was no biggie, I am home for the grow anyway. I considered STS, but silver nitrate was hard for me to get where I live. The silver wire was easy and cheaper, and looks like it will outlast me at the rate it is going.
